Abstract

This research is motivated by the absence of tools and guidelines for the density practicum at the Physics Laboratory, UNIMA, so that the practicum activities are not carried out. The purpose of this research is to produce a product of tools and guidelines for practicum density using guided inquiry learning models. This research is a research and development study using the 4 D research model adapted from the Thiagarajan model, which is difine, design, develop and disseminate. The number of students taken is 8 people for the small group test and 16 people for the large group test. The data analysis technique was done descriptively with several types of assessment including cognitive and psychomotor. At the last meeting, students were given a questionnaire to see student responses to density practical tools and guidelines, the results of the questionnaire proved that 97.87% thought that tools and practical guides were very useful (SB) in experimental activities. Based on the results of the study it can be concluded that the product of the tools and guidelines for density practice using guided inquiry learning models with very good and proper qualifications.      Keywords: Practicum Guide, Research and Development, Hydrostatic Pressure,

Abstract

This research is motivated by the absence of practicum guides for one-phase and three-phase generator tools so that students lack expertise in using these tools in experimenting. The purpose of this study is to produce a physics practicum guidance product on a one-phase and three-phase generator using a guided inquiry model with mentoring. This research is a research and development study using the 4D research model adapted from the Thiagarajan model, which is define, design, develop and disseminate. The results of the study for mentors and groups get an average value of 86.45%, so that the guidelines fall into the feasible / valid category. and on the response of mentors and students 47.17% chose very useful (SB), 51.43% chose useful (B) and 1.4% chose less useful (KB) none voted unhelpful (TB). Based on the results of the study it can be concluded that a product has been produced in the form of a basic physics practicum guide for one-phase and three-phase generator tools using a guided inquiry learning model with good and proper qualifications. Keywords: Practicum guide, Research and Development, one-phase and three-phase generators, guided inquiry, mentoring.
